XWEB500-XWEB500D: Monitoring and Controlling Web Server

it is extremely well suited for medium installations up to 36 or 100 devices, such as petrol stations, supermarkets or storage centres. Its innovative and useful features make the instrument suitable for medium-large applications such as production and storage goods centres. Thanks to its 2 available formats, it can be installed whether on DIN Rail or wall or panel mounting, but can also be used as desk instrument. Local or remote connection from PC is made without the need of special software, only standard web browser (Microsoft Internet Explorer® or Firefox®) software is needed; the information is displayed as Web pages.
- Monitoring and controlling web server connectable to Dixell’s controllers with serial output or to others ModBUS-RTU compatible devices
- The unit can operate as a stand-alone server by means of the local keyboard and display (XWEB500)
- Electrical panel board on DIN Rail mounting (XWEB500D)
- Structure based on Linux operative system with WEB pages
- Controller values display and parameter and alarm management
- Powerfull tool to view graphs and export in Microsoft Excel® format
- Calendar function for alarm transmission to the “in charge” service
- Alarm sending via FAX, SMS or e-mail
- Command sending activation through digital input
- Possibility to have a connection with a PDA or Smartphone
- Local or remote connection from PC using standard browser (Microsoft Internet Explorer® or Firefox®) for the data management and display
- 48MB or 128MB internal memory to store 1 year of data with 15min sampling time (36 or 100 controllers)
- Standard communication protocol ModBUS-RTU
- 15VA max power absorption for XWEB500D and 20VA max power absorption for XWEB500

- 200MHz CPU
- 48MB internal memory (36 controllers) and 128MB internal
- memory (100 controllers)
- 24Vac power supply (XWEB500D only) or 110, 230Vac ±10%
- 1 LAN output
- 1 USB output (XWEB500D) – 2 USB outputs (XWEB500)
- 1 RS485 serial line for device (ModBUS – RTU) connection
- 1 RS232 output for external modem connection
- 1 system alarm relay output
- 2 RS485 alarm relay outputs
- 1 digital input
- Sampling time programmable from 1 to 60 minutes
- Optional analogue internal modem or GSM
- Direct power supply for GSM modem (XWEB500D)

A clear and concise alarm signalling to a service centre, is one of the most popular features of XWEB500. Alarms can be sent via Fax, e-mail,SMS and also by means of 2 on-board relays. Several typologies for the sending of alarms guarantees the customer a wide choice; in this way the kind of peripheral is not a restriction and the intervention time will be drastically reduced. It is possible to connect to the XWEB500, XWEB500D also by palmtop displaying all the values of the device and sending it commands.
|
|
|

XWEB500D , XWEB500 Server, installed in the system to monitor, can be remotely linked by several methods :
- by Modem with point to point connection, also on GSM modem;
- by link in local Ethernet network, by means of standard net connector RJ45;
- by direct Internet connection
